Historical Society of Pennsylvania

John Fea   |  September 18, 2008

I took the train into Philadelphia today for an evening book talk and signing at the Historical Society of Pennsylvania. My talk on The Way of Improvement Leads Home was part of a program entitled “The People of Revolutionary America.” I shared the night with John Nagy, an independent historian and the author of Rebellion in the Ranks. John probably knows more about mutinies during the American Revolution than anyone else alive. Thanks to Christi B. for the invitation.

I am off to Ohio tomorrow morning for the biennial meeting of the Conference on Faith and History.
